Workers部署

登录Cloudflare之后,打开Workers,创建一个新的Worker,在worker.js中输入如下内容,并将workers_url的内容替换成自己的域名,例如(https://hub.domain.com)。然后点击部署

部署完之后,在该worker的“设置”选项中找到“触发器”,点击"添加自定义域"。将js中workers_url定义的域名添加进去,等待几分钟之后域名解析生效。

拉取规则

在直接使用官方Docker Hub拉取镜像时,一般的格式有以下两种

docker pull nginx
docker pull gitlab/gitlab-ce

第一种是官方镜像,全部的结构格式为docker.io/library/nginx。在docker hub上搜索时就能看到Official Images字样。

替换之后则是hub.domain.com/library/nginx

docker pull hub.domain.com/library/nginx:latest

第二种是社区镜像,全部的结构格式为docker.io/gitlab/gitlab-ce 替换之后的则是hub.domain.com/gitlab/gitlab-ce

docker pull hub.domain.com/gitlab/gitlab-ce:latest
